Welcome to Episode 20 of Bears on Film.

Ahoy, me hearties! Join us as we sail the seas with a scantily-clad slave girl and a man with a golden face, on a quest to find a magical fountain. While on this quest we'll discuss the magic of Ray Harryhausen's work, the charisma (or lack there of) of John Phillip Law, who plays Sinbad, and whether or not the use of dark magic will create constipation for the user. That's right, we're watching 1973's 'The Golden Voyage of Sinbad'. Could this be the most divisive adventure the Bears have ever had?
